Warehouse ChallengeManagement - Systems and Technologies

Learning Results

Learning objectives involve analyzing the principles of management of logistics centers, from a perspective of theirdigital transformation and managing this change based on a technological paradigm based on new informationtechnologies, in particular on warehouse management systems, whether or not included in a single integrated ERPmanagement system. Warehouse management is complex, with thousands of unique item codes with thousands ofunits stored in inventory. It is intended to address the main sub-processes taking place in the facilities, such asreceiving, separating and dispatching items, with synchronization between them. Technologies to track and managethe operation and integrations with other autonomous systems will be discussed. It is intended to exercisefunctionalities of a warehouse management system in practice and design a solution for a given organization.Challenges and opportunities of information systems and technologies in warehouse management will be discussed.
